I Plant a Garden With My Mom
by Paula Papazoglu
Being outside is wonderful—watching the worms squirm, the grass grow and the flowers flourish. It’s even better when you’re in a garden you’ve planted yourself, as Johnny discovers when he spends time digging, planting and watering a little garden with his mom. As the garden grows and the beautiful colors appear all around them, Dad is able to get involved too: he can teach Johnny all the names of the flowers that Johnny has helped to plant.
I Plant a Garden with my Mom is a book for children, teaching kids about responsibility, nurturing, cooperation and family, and the simple joy of helping Mother Nature do her job. Written in charming rhyme by Paula Papazoglu and accompanied by Susan Gumm’s beautiful, lavish illustrations, I Plant a Garden with my Mom will soothe the soul and give kids some great ideas about getting out and having fun.
